Was having some trouble holding RPMs on my 2013 925 proclimb, decided to rebuild the secondary and found a broken helix post. From the wear and discoloration, it's clear that this is not a fresh crack, looks like it's been this way for quite a long time. Had I found this before I bought all the parts I might have swapped to the Team clutch. Is this common?

It's not that uncommon. Especially if a helix bolt starts coming loose. Thunder products has Hercules helixes that are much stouter built.

Hercules helix is the ticket. The clutch is prolly worn out so a new helix will only bandaid the problem. I recommend buying a complete new clutch,
